1

我正在使用django-wysihtml5在管理员中获取富文本功能,并且效果很好。

我想知道是否有任何选项可以使用这个 django 库在前端(不仅是管理员)使用的表单中获得相同的功能。也许我们必须在ModelForm __init__()方法中指定一个小部件?

非常感谢!

4

1 回答 1

3

django-wysihtml5中的示例项目现在实现了您正在寻找的用例。它使用 bootstrap-wysihtml5 作为公共接口。

完成这项工作的关键文件是:

  • demo/twitter_bootstrap.py:实现 ModelForm 中使用的 django 小部件
  • demo/articles/forms.py:为文章实现 ModelForm

要查看实际演示,请创建一个 virtualenv,git clone 应用程序,然后按照步骤安装演示站点

于 2013-05-06T07:31:27.143 回答